The Origins of Basketball:

The roots of basketball can be traced back to the late 19th century when Dr. James Naismith, a Canadian physical education instructor, invented the game as a means to keep his students active during the winter months. Little did he know that his creation would evolve into a global phenomenon, captivating audiences and athletes alike.

The Basics of the Game:

Basketball is played between two teams, each consisting of five players. The objective is to score points by shooting the ball through the opponent’s basket, a hoop suspended 10 feet above the floor. The game is divided into four quarters, each lasting 12 minutes in professional leagues, with additional time allotted in case of a tie.

The Court:

The basketball court is a meticulously designed arena, featuring a three-point line, free-throw line, and key or paint area. The court dimensions adhere to specific regulations, ensuring a standardized playing environment across the globe.

The Fast Break and Transition Game:

Speed and agility are pivotal in the fast-paced world of basketball. The fast break, a rapid offensive play initiated by quick transitions from defense to offense, showcases the athleticism and coordination of a team in motion. It is in these moments that the game reaches its zenith, as players sprint down the court, making split-second decisions to capitalize on scoring opportunities.

The Three-Point Shot:

Introduced in the late 20th century, the three-point shot revolutionized basketball strategy. Beyond the arc, players display their shooting prowess, adding an extra layer of excitement and unpredictability to the game. A well-executed three-pointer can shift the momentum and electrify the crowd, making it a thrilling aspect of modern basketball.
